    I would recommendTekken 6 as well if you're looking for offline content. The game is a lot of fun to play in normal versus; plus, it has a beat-em'-up campaign mode (which I think you can play in local co-op) and tons of cosmetic unlockables for the entire cast. And a used copy of Tekken 6 should also only set you back $20 or less.

    You should also consider Mortal Kombat if you're hungry for offline content. It has a massive, wall-produced campaign mode, a lengthy challenge tower full of interesting missions, and lots of unlockable content that reward you for playing. Online play is there as well when you're ready, and you can play cooperatively with a friend in tag battles. The game is a bit more expensive, but it's worth it (if you don't mind all the gore).
